# D2DF Tools
[!] Notice: On some modern devices it may not work because the security system is constantly being updated
I have tried on my xiomi fog (Android 11) device, Default folder named MIUI refuses to turn off, I really regret that. but I also can not do much.
## Information
D2DF stands for Destroy or Disable the Default Folder a small tool to disable some folder-related features
or permanently delete unwanted folders on sdcard, delete them normally media system can still create folders automatically when booting is complete
on sdcard, Now they are no longer.
This is an example of an Default folder: `DCIM` , `Pictures` , `Music` , `Download` and other.
## What For
- Folders become more compact because only the important ones are displayed
- Do not take excessive screenshots, activate if needed
- If `DCIM` Folder is turned off the Camera system is forced to select the MicroSd Card storage path, Configure your camera app first.
- And maybe many more.
## Feature
No root required[^1].
No busybox installed[^2].
Colorful & Simple[^3].
